Truss Framing in Wilmington, NC
Truss framing services involve the construction and installation of prefabricated triangular structures that form the framework of a building’s roof or floors. These systems are essential for providing support and stability in residential projects, including new home construction, additions, or renovations that require a strong, reliable roof structure. Property owners often request truss framing when planning a new roof, attic conversion, or any project that demands precise, durable support systems to ensure the integrity of the building’s framework.
Before requesting truss framing services, homeowners should consider the scope of their project, including the size and design of the structure, as well as any specific load requirements or architectural preferences. Understanding the type of trusses needed-such as standard, engineered, or custom designs-can help ensure the framing aligns with the overall construction plan. Clear communication about the property’s existing structure and future plans can assist in selecting the most suitable framing options to support the building’s safety and longevity.

Truss Framing Questions
What is truss framing used for? Truss framing is commonly used in roof and floor structures to provide strong, stable support for residential and commercial buildings in Wilmington and nearby areas.
What types of projects typically require truss framing? Truss framing is often requested for new construction, additions, or remodels that need durable support for roofs, floors, or ceilings.
How does truss framing benefit property owners? Truss framing offers efficient load distribution, quick installation, and reliable structural support for various building types.
Is truss framing suitable for all building styles? Truss framing can be adapted to a wide range of architectural designs, making it versatile for different property styles and needs.
